Qual o tamanho dos seus objetivos?
Deseja novos desafios?
Então, vem para TQI!
Você fará parte de times diversos e de alta performance, em um ambiente descontraído, dinâmico e colaborativo.
Para nós, a voz e contribuição de todos é fundamental para a construção das nossas soluções e para nossas tomadas de decisões.
Aqui, as pessoas são o diferencial.
Somos apaixonados por tecnologia, inovação e evolução constante.
Conheça mais sobre essa vaga: Desenvolvimento de Back-End: Implementar e manter serviços e aplicações utilizando NodeJS e TypeScript, integrando APIs com GraphQL e RestAPIs.
Gerenciamento de Código: Usar Git e seguir práticas de git-flow, colaborando em pull requests e code reviews.
Serviços em Nuvem: Desenvolver e manter aplicações na AWS Cloud, garantindo escalabilidade, desempenho e segurança.
Princípios de Engenharia de Software: Aplicar os princípios SOLID e boas práticas de design para criar soluções modulares e reutilizáveis.
Testes Automatizados: Criar e manter testes unitários e de integração com Jest, assegurando a qualidade do código.
Metodologias Ágeis: Participar ativamente de cerimônias ágeis e colaborar para entregar valor de forma iterativa e incremental.
Code Reviews e Feedback: Realizar code reviews construtivos e estar aberto a receber críticas construtivas.
Arquitetura de Software: Projetar e implementar soluções seguindo a arquitetura Hexagonal (Ports & Adapters) e documentar a arquitetura do sistema.
Colaboração e Comunicação: Trabalhar de forma eficaz com desenvolvedores, designers, product owners e outras partes interessadas, comunicando claramente o progresso do trabalho.
Manutenção e Suporte: Manter e melhorar o código existente, resolver problemas técnicos em produção e explorar novas tecnologias para propor melhorias.
O que você precisa saber: Experiência em NodeJS Experiência em TypeScript Experiência em apis com graphql Experiência em RestApis Experiência com ferramenta de versionamento de código git Experiência com git-flow Experiência com serviços AWS Cloud Conhecimentos sólidos em SOLID Experiência com biblioteca de teste Jest e Experiência em criação de testes unitários e de integração Experiência em metodologias ágeis Estar aberto a críticas construtivas e correções em code reviews Será um diferencial: Conhecimento em arquitetura Hexagonal (Ports & Adapters) Conhecimentos em Apigee #VempraTQI